Understanding PCIe generations and compatibility is the compass you carry. The PS5 demands PCIe Gen4 x4 and an M.2 NVMe in sizes typically 2230 to 2280. A dedicated heatsink is often part of the equation, as cooling preserves performance inside the console’s enclosure. Seek drives that offer 5500 MB/s or faster sequential reads to meet the console’s expectations.

PS5 accepts a family of compact form factors, shaping a practical range for upgrades. Consider these lengths as a map to fit and airflow:
- 2230
- 2242
- 2260
- 2280
Beyond size, seek drives with well-engineered heat spreaders or heatsinks to keep sustained performance in check. A drive that stays cool feels almost magical, letting you roam vast digital worlds without pause.

Thermal management rests on a few truths: a well-designed heatsink, efficient airflow, and solid thermal interfaces. A drive that stays cool under pressure tends to preserve peak sustained speeds rather than surrender to throttling. Here are the hallmarks to look for when evaluating options:
- Integrated heatsink and broad contact area for rapid heat dissipation
- Low-profile design that fits PS5 snugly without blocking vents
- Quality thermal pads and copper spreaders for stable temps

Benchmark tools like CrystalDiskMark, ATTO, and Anvil’s Storage Utilities quantify how a drive behaves under real-game loads. Read results by focusing on sustained throughput (MB/s), random IOPS, and latency under load—the rhythm you notice between missions is the true measure, not peak bursts.

Common misconceptions about PS5 NVMe speed include the belief that peak speed is the sole compass, that any PCIe 4.0 SSD will perform identically in the console, and that thermal quirks never sting mid-mission.
- Myth: peak speed guarantees smooth texture streaming everywhere.
- Myth: all PCIe 4.0 NVMe drives behave the same in PS5.
- Myth: cooling or throttling never affects in-game performance.
In truth, the steady cadence under load shapes the long haul, turning sprawling worlds into a patient glide rather than a sprint followed by stutter.
